Transaction 75cfcd29496bad198caba7b668bb0b50b93ed7ab848d9711136b08f84aded510

1 Input
2 Outputs
  • 75cfcd29496bad198caba7b668bb0b50b93ed7ab848d9711136b08f84aded510:0
  • value  1951015
    address  1AmmExLfea38FA5g6w8soAqEggFhBKsrW
  • 75cfcd29496bad198caba7b668bb0b50b93ed7ab848d9711136b08f84aded510:1
  • value  1282932080
    address  18WmCbVhdg1ErscpkS8KPVoXJ2GnNvGTjs